Understanding ADHD and the Need for Diagnosis
ADHD is characterized by a persistent pattern of negligence and/or hyperactivity-impulsivity that interferes with operating or development. Although the exact causes remain uncertain, genetics, environment, and brain structure are believed to contribute.

The journey typically starts with a preliminary assessment with a qualified healthcare specialist, such as a psychiatrist or psychologist. This meeting intends to talk about symptoms, medical history, and any previous assessments.
Action 2: Comprehensive Assessment
During the assessment stage, specialists will carry out:
Clinical interviews: Discussing history and behaviourStandardized rating scales: Utilized to evaluate symptom intensityObservational assessments: Noting behaviour in numerous settingsStep 3: Feedback Session
After the assessments are completed, a feedback session is set up. Here, the health care service provider will go over the outcomes, offer the diagnosis (if relevant), and suggest management techniques.
Step 4: Follow-Up Care
Post-diagnosis, individuals can take advantage of follow-up appointments to monitor development and make any needed changes to treatment.

While there are many benefits to acquiring a private diagnosis, people need to also understand possible downsides, consisting of:

How much does a private ADHD diagnosis cost?
The cost for a private ADHD diagnosis can vary extensively, varying from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,500 depending on the degree of the assessments, area, and particular services offered.
2. The length of time does the assessment take?
The assessment typically lasts from one to three hours, depending upon the person's requirements and the particular tests administered. Follow-up sessions may likewise be essential.
3. Is a private diagnosis valid?
Yes, a valid diagnosis from a certified professional is acknowledged by healthcare systems and universities. Finally, it's important to ensure the practitioner is accredited and follows standardized assessment procedures.
4. Can I get treatment from the same supplier?
The majority of private diagnosis centers likewise offer treatment services, including medication management, treatment, and support system. It's advisable to ask throughout the preliminary consultation.
5. Can I receive assistance if I have a private diagnosis?
Definitely. Numerous companies and regional support system offer resources and information for people identified with ADHD, despite whether the diagnosis was made openly or privately.
